 * I operate a WordPress site with multiple authors. I would like to know if there
   is a way to have a line of code entered at the end of a post no matter which 
   author posted automatically. For example, to add a text link ad.

 * Certainly. Where you would add the code depends on your theme. Find out which
   file you’ll need to edit by examining your [template hierarchy](http://codex.wordpress.org/Template_Hierarchy),
   and once you find that, open the file and after the post add in your code.
